Crypto Founder Predicts This Altcoin Sweetheart Will Overtake Solana, But How Far Will It Go?
BitMEX co-founder Arthur Hayes has publicly predicted that Hyperliquid (HYPE) will overtake Solana before the current market cycle concludes, maintaining a $150 price target for the token by mid-year. The prediction reflects growing confidence in Hyperliquid's competitive positioning within the Layer 1 blockchain ecosystem.
Arthur Hayes's prediction represents a significant endorsement from a prominent figure in crypto markets, though it requires careful contextualization. Hayes has established credibility as a market analyst through BitMEX's influence, yet his public price targets often reflect bullish positioning rather than dispassionate analysis. The claim that Hyperliquid will overtake Solana depends critically on market capitalization metrics and adoption velocity during a specific timeframe.
Hyperliquid has gained traction as a derivatives-focused blockchain, differentiating itself from Solana's broader ecosystem approach. The altcoin sector has historically experienced dramatic revaluations during bull markets, with smaller projects capturing outsized gains. However, Solana maintains substantial advantages: deeper liquidity, broader developer adoption, established institutional relationships, and a larger holder base. The $150 HYPE target implies significant appreciation from current levels, requiring sustained buying pressure and positive catalysts.
For investors, Hayes's prediction signals confidence in Hyperliquid's fundamental positioning but shouldn't serve as investment rationale alone. The cryptocurrency market remains speculative, and even credible analysts miscalculate timing and adoption curves. Such predictions may influence retail sentiment and create self-fulfilling dynamics if widely adopted.
Monitoring Hyperliquid's development progress, exchange listings, and Total Value Locked will reveal whether technological improvements support price appreciation. Solana's continued performance and ecosystem strength will determine competitive dynamics. Market cycles are unpredictable, and mid-year timeframes are aggressive targets for such radical market shifts.
